How long does it take to obtain a duplicate identity card in Chile?

The issuance time for a duplicate ID card in Chile may vary, but is generally delivered within 10 to 15 business days.

What are the tax implications of receiving payments for digital marketing services in Brazil?

Brazil Payments for digital marketing services received in Brazil are subject to taxes such as Income Tax (IR) and Financial Operations Tax (IOF). The IR tax rate may vary depending on the nature of the services and the applicable tax regime. It is important to consider these tax obligations and seek appropriate advice to comply with applicable tax regulations.

How do you obtain the PIS number in Brazil?

The PIS number is obtained through registration in the Social Integration Program at Caixa Econômica Federal. It is usually assigned automatically when obtaining the Carteira de Trabalho.

What impact can disciplinary records have on the adoption of minors in the Dominican Republic?

Disciplinary records can influence the process of adopting minors in the Dominican Republic. Adoption authorities may consider this background when evaluating the suitability of applicants and ensuring the safety and well-being of adopted children. Disciplinary history may influence the approval or denial of the adoption.

What is the role of financial education in preventing money laundering in Venezuela?

Financial education plays a crucial role in preventing money laundering in Venezuela. By providing knowledge and skills about the financial system, legitimate transactions, and the risks associated with money laundering, financial education empowers citizens to recognize and report suspicious activity. In addition, financial education fosters a culture of transparency, ethics and compliance with laws, which contributes to the prevention of money laundering from the grassroots of society.

What is the role of the Ministry of Cooperative Development in Panama?

The Ministry of Cooperative Development of Panama has the responsibility of promoting and strengthening the cooperative sector in the country. Its function is to support the creation and development of cooperatives, promote cooperative education and training, and promote the solidarity economy and citizen participation through cooperatives.
